Caring for teeth after whitening treatments
Below, we have addressed the best ways to care for the teeth once they have completed a whitening treatment, whether that be bleaching agents or whitening strips.
Avoid coffees, teas and wines
Just like any other day, it is still important to try and avoid heavy use of coffees, teas and wines. These beverages are extremely heavy in dyes which often stain the teeth. It is extremely important to avoid them immediately after the whitening treatment because the teeth are more sensitive thus allowing for a stronger chance of staining.
Use a sensitivity toothpaste
A lot of people note that they experience sensitivity to their teeth immediately after their whitening treatments. If this is the case, then make use of a toothpaste that is for sensitive teeth. A dentist can recommend one or a person can find one at a local drugstore. Avoid drinks or foods that may be extreme in temperature as this will also avoid any sensitivity to hot and cold.
Brush after each meal
Although it isn’t always necessary to brush after each meal, it doesn’t hurt. Once a whitening treatment is complete, the teeth are more prone to staining or damage because they are sensitive. It has been said to brush the teeth after consuming any foods or beverages once a whitening treatment has been done. This will ensure that any foods or beverages won’t leave behind any particles that may stain the teeth thus reversing the whitening.
